Period:Qing dynasty Production date:1857
Materials:paper
Technique:printed
Subjects:dragon
Dimensions:Height: 242.50 millimetres Width: 137.50 millimetres
Description:
Banknote. Government note with denomination in cash coins. Great Qing Treasure Note (Da Qing baochao) fo12,000 wen (cash).
IMG
![图片[3]-banknote BM-1996-0217.2436-China Archive](https://chinaarchive.net/Qin dynasty/43/mid_00800568_001.jpg)
Comments:This note was also included in the World of Money CD-Rom (BM Multimedia, 1998)
